Subject: bug#9398: can no longer suspend emacs and get back to the shell

Starting with
emacs-snapshot:
Installed: 1:20110827-1
one can no longer do
$ emacs
C-z
and expect to be able to type anything to the shell.
One now needs to do
$ emacs &
beforehand for that.
